http://energybooks.com/energy-efficiency-manual/table-of-contents/reference-notes/note-36-variable-speed/ black bar stool cushionsWebGenerally, when measuring high voltage and high current transformer signals, you use a VT (voltage transformer) and CT (current transformer). The ratios between the primary and secondary rated voltages and rated currents are the VT and CT ratios.
